About this scholarship

Established in 2006 in memory of Cecilie Anne Sloane, a former tutor and lecturer in the Department of English at The University of Queensland, and maintained by the income from a perpetual endowment fund setup by a gift from her brother-in-law, RF (Ron) Diamond, and her sister, HM (Helen) Diamond. The purpose of the scholarship is to enable a Higher Degree by Research candidate to undertake English language creative writing research within The University of Queensland.

Eligibility

You are eligible if you are a PhD candidate researching in the field of creative writing

How to apply

You must submit the following documents to the School of Communication and Arts HLO (hdr.commarts@enquire.uq.edu.au)  by 11:59pm Monday, 25 August 2025.

  • a cover letter addressing the selection criteria, noting academic and creative writing achievements, and stating how the $2000 would be used to support their research
  • the version of the prospectus as at time of confirmation
  • a copy of your Confirmation Milestone report

You must also request a confidential referee report written by your principal advisor, or by your associate advisor if the principal advisor is on the selection committee.  This report is to be submitted by your advisor to the School of Communication and Arts HLO (hdr.commarts@enquire.uq.edu.au) by the application deadline.

Selection criteria

Your application will be ranked on the basis of:

  • academic achievement and potential for scholastic success; and
  • the quality of the your academic and research work throughout your academic career, including demonstrated aptitude, suitability and potential for original research; and
  • your experience and achievement in English language creative writing.
  • any other matters the selection committee sees fit.

Selection of a scholar will be made by the Dean of the Graduate School on the advice of a selection committee comprised of:

  • Academic staff from the School of Communication and Arts; and
  • Non-university experts in the field of English language creative writing, with university academic staff in the majority.

The scholar must, not more than 3 months after the scholarship ends, submit to the selection committee a full and final written report, suitable for circulation within the university, of the progress and outcome of the research undertaken during the tenure of the scholarship.
